Welcome to What Is Rich?, a docuseries exploring how wealth is truly built, sustained, and defined—beyond money, hype, and social media success.

In this episode, host Jerome D. Love travels across Houston, Atlanta, and beyond to sit down with iconic entrepreneurs and cultural leaders to unpack legacy, ownership, and what it really means to be rich.

Featured conversations include:
• Percy Creuzot King of the legendary Frenchy’s Chicken, sharing a 60-year family business story rooted in property ownership, innovation, and generational legacy
• Ryan Wilson, Founder of The Gathering Spot, on building spaces that create access, connection, and opportunity
• Will Packer, billion-dollar Hollywood producer and New York Times bestselling author, breaking down how fulfillment, relationships, and resourcefulness shaped his definition of wealth
From bartering and in-kind capital to scaling businesses, drive-thru innovation, and redefining success, this episode challenges the idea that being “rich” is just about money—and reframes it as strategy, access, and long-term vision.
